Transaction 76260f58fbca0bcc4e7a6c208e642ca9a97f7d66cb70702c4e25ae433c2d9998
1 Input
1 Output
-
76260f58fbca0bcc4e7a6c208e642ca9a97f7d66cb70702c4e25ae433c2d9998:0
- value
- 215801
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 95651e9e15ae8eb5afe1618977e28ebd932a4a54 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EcvpVkWEyrEVXSZZkiUzryXqBiQ132KPU